A Simple Key For API Development Company Unveiled
A Simple Key For API Development Company Unveiled
Blog Article
Samples of productive tasks that benefited from creating an API from scratch as opposed to integrating:
Messaging integrations Integrations with messaging and interaction platforms, such as Slack and Twilio, help groups improve collaboration and streamline essential workflows.
You can utilize the network's research functionality if you're looking for something precise, or browse by class if you want to get inspired. You will also have entry to public documentation, which could increase the integration approach and decrease your time and effort to very first phone.
Integrating APIs into a person's purposes can convey a variety of Gains to a person or an organization, which may involve:
Regular Knowledge Format: Distinctive APIs may well return facts in several formats. Your backend can standardize these formats, making certain that your frontend only requires to manage a dependable framework. This lowers complexity within the client side and makes your code a lot easier to keep up.
Custom integration necessitates far more work and assets than making use of pre-current APIs, but Furthermore, it delivers greater versatility and control in excess of the integration.
API integration can significantly develop what your purposes can do, enabling you to offer richer characteristics even though retaining a sleek user expertise.
APIs that deliver precisely the same data several situations can gain from caching. Implement HTTP caching with headers like Cache-Manage to lessen server load and reduce response situations. Use approaches like ETags for cache validation.
one. Effectiveness: API integration automates the transfer of data and info from just one application to the following, which was previously accomplished manually by a payroll worker.
RESTful APIs use HTTP strategies as operations to communicate with assets. Below’s a fundamental evaluation of the commonest solutions:
Automation of Manual Processes: APIs allow businesses to automate repetitive duties, liberating up useful time and sources. As an example, in API integration in e-commerce, APIs can link your order administration process with the stock to automate stock updates. Scalability: Whether or not your business is growing or you might be adopting new systems, API integrations supply the flexibility to scale. API integration in cloud computing is a wonderful example of how cloud-based devices can easily scale with the assistance of APIs. Improved Information Precision: By integrating APIs, it is possible to make certain that your systems are generally up to date in serious-time, cutting down the chance of human mistake.
Cleaning soap APIs are noted for their robustness, earning them perfect for industries necessitating substantial-degree security and trustworthiness.
Knowledge the API vs. integration distinction and figuring out which a person to utilize And just how is essential for building, handling, employing, and acquiring computer software proficiently. Also, it can help you offer you a far better reference for your crew of what you require and wish. In addition to realizing the distinction between api check here and integration, it’s important to know how to utilize equally, not only a single or the opposite.
Scope of communication. If you actually need to access and modify certain capabilities or info in A different method, use an API.